Purpose of Payment Bonds



If you wish to comprehend the significance of settlement bonds, you need to initially grasp their primary function in building projects. Repayment bonds act as a critical defense device for subcontractors and suppliers. Payment bonds serve as a warranty that subcontractors and suppliers will certainly obtain payment for their job and materials, even if the specialist defaults.

By requiring repayment bonds on tasks, task owners make sure that all parties involved in the building and construction process are economically safe and secure. This requirement provides assurance to subcontractors and suppliers, urging them to participate in tasks without the fear of non-payment. Just How Payment Bonds Are Obtained



To obtain repayment bonds for construction jobs, contractors normally come close to surety business that concentrate on supplying these financial assurances. Surety companies analyze the service provider's economic security, credit reliability, and task background before issuing a repayment bond. The specialist needs to finish an application process that includes sending financial documents and project information for examination.

Mechanics of Payment Bonds



Recognizing the technicians of repayment bonds is important for navigating the intricacies of building and construction job funding. Repayment bonds are a three-party agreement amongst the project owner, the specialist, and the guaranty business. Once a contractor is awarded a project, they normally obtain a repayment bond to guarantee that subcontractors, workers, and providers are spent for their work and products. In case the specialist stops working to fulfill repayment commitments, the settlement bond remains in place to offer a source of funds for these celebrations.

When a subcontractor or supplier goes unpaid, they can make a case versus the repayment bond.
